EnverPortal: http://www.envertecportal.com The Envertech microinverter maximizes energy production from your photovoltaic (PV) array. Each Envertech microinverter is individually connected to one PV module in your array. This unique conjuration means that an individual Maximum Peak Power Point Tracker (MPPT) controls each PV module. This...
The distributed nature of a microinverter system ensures that there is no single point failure in the PV system. Envertech Microinverters are designed to operate at full power at ambient temperatures as high as +65 ℃ (150 ℉ ). The microinverter casing is designed for outdoor installation and complies with the IP67 protection level.

The Envertech microinverter is powered on when there is sufficient DC voltage from the PV module. The LED light of each microinverter will blink green to indicate normal start-up operation approximately 1 minute after DC power is applied. 7.
